Summary

Global commerce continues to rely on outdated cross-border payment systems that are inefficient and costly, creating challenges for businesses that must navigate delays, trapped capital, and opaque fees. The traditional correspondent banking model and card networks, while historically effective, now act as bottlenecks due to their complex, multi-party structures and slow settlement times. These inefficiencies result in significant financial strain for enterprises, including the immobilization of capital in prefunded accounts and high compliance costs due to redundant regulatory checks. The Circle Payments Network (CPN) offers a modern solution by facilitating real-time, transparent settlements using stablecoins like USDC and EURC, aiming to transform global payments into a seamless, efficient process. CPN, supported by Circle's programmable infrastructure, enables continuous operations and integrates compliance within transactions, promoting a more open and interconnected financial system.
